Abstract

The effects of specular multipath on the reconstruction of high resolution target image provided by an inverse synthetic aperture radar (ISAR) are investigated. First, a model of the received signal that takes into account the reflections produced by the surface of the Earth is defined, Then, the impulse response of the imaging system used to reconstruct the reflectivity function of the target is evaluated. Finally, the theoretical analysis is validated by some simulation results relative to different motion conditions.
